摘要:
1,接口的多个实现 group 2, 阅读全文
摘要:
1. solr查询 or and要大写 阅读全文
摘要:
1, 存储过程 定义是编译一次 快 一次多条sql减少网络负载 重复使用 安全性高 2, 3nf 阅读全文
摘要:
1, ReentrantReadWriteLock是Lock的另一种实现方式,我们已经知道了ReentrantLock是一个排他锁,同一时间只允许一个线程访问,而ReentrantReadWriteLock允许多个读线程同时访问,但不允许写线程和读线程、写线程和写线程同时访问。相对于排他锁,提高了并 阅读全文
摘要:
ApplicationContext接口常用实现类***ClassPathXmlApplicationContext: 它是从类的根路径下加载配置文件 推荐使用这种***FileSystemXmlApplicationContext: 它是从磁盘路径上加载配置文件,配置文件可以在磁盘的任意位置。* 阅读全文
摘要:
1,DispatcherServlet初始化的主要工作就是为了创建Spring容器 阅读全文
摘要:
如果是一个大型的网站,内部子系统较多、接口非常多的情况下,RPC框架的好处就显示出来了,首先就是长链接,不必每次通信都要像http 一样去3次握手什么的,减少了网络开销;其次就是RPC框架一般都有注册中心,有丰富的监控管理;发布、下线接口、动态扩展等,对调用方来说是无感知、统 一化的操作。第三个来说 阅读全文
摘要:
1, response.sendRedirect() 重定向 返回后重新生成一个请求 request。getRequestDispatcher.forward 类似于方法调用 同一个请求 直接返回 2, filter取你所想取 拦截器(代理) 拒你所想拒 3, cookie session cook 阅读全文
摘要:
1,RabbitMq:它比kafka成熟,支持AMQP协议(跨语言)处理,在可靠性上,RabbitMq超过kafka,在性能方面超过ActiveMQ。 数据一致性 完整性好Kafka:Kafka设计的初衷就是处理日志的,不支持AMQP事务处理,可以看做是一个日志系统,针对性很强,所以它并没有具备一个 阅读全文
摘要:
nginx反向代理 负载均衡 keepalive高可用 lvs负载均衡算法 mvn build自定义命令 install安装到本地仓库 阅读全文